Bill Summary

A BILL To require the Assistant Secretary of Commerce for Commu- nications and Information to establish a State Digital Equity Capacity Grant Program, and for other purposes.

AI Summary

This bill, the Digital Equity Act of 2021, would establish a State Digital Equity Capacity Grant Program and a Digital Equity Competitive Grant Program to promote digital equity and inclusion. The bill defines key terms like "digital equity" and "digital inclusion," and requires the Assistant Secretary of Commerce for Communications and Information to administer the programs, consult with other federal agencies, and report on the programs' progress and impact. The bill authorizes funding for the programs and includes provisions related to nondiscrimination, technological neutrality, and oversight. Overall, the bill aims to help ensure all individuals and communities in the United States have access to and can effectively use affordable information and communication technologies.
